Q2 Planning Note — Licensing Dispute

The dispute with Harkwell Systems over the Pentamere toolkit licence remains unresolved. Counsel expects mediation within six weeks. Branches should continue using version 4 only and log any Harkwell contact with head office. No customer communications until further notice. The confidential note below covers the business plans affected.

confidential, kagup-bafog: Fraaxax Group is in early talks to buy Soroxox Group for about $343.8 million. The Olidor launch date is June 14, and nothing goes to the press before then. Legal wants the Aldmirek Logistics term sheet signed before July 23.

**Ticket #4412 — CSV Import Wizard failing with 401**

The Grainview import wizard stopped accepting uploads this morning. Root cause: the service credential for the parse-queue backend expired over the weekend and auto-renewal was never enabled. Support should advise affected customers to retry after redeploy. A replacement credential has been issued and validated against staging. For reference during the rollout, the new key is below.

API key for yahig-tadup: kto7_ubizbYm

Quarterly Planning Note — Lease Renegotiation, Dunmere Office

Hi finance team,

Quick heads-up: we're back at the table with the landlord of the Dunmere site. Current terms run out in March, and we're pushing for a three-year extension at a lower rate per square metre, plus a break clause. Expect some back-and-forth in the next two cycles, so keep a placeholder in the occupancy budget. Orla is leading negotiations. The confidential note just below sets out where this fits in our wider plans.

internal memo for kagaf-yajog: The western region missed its Kasvan quota by 63.4 percent last quarter. Casethox Holdings plans to raise the Lamvan list price by 43.5 percent in January. The finance team signed off on a budget of $404.3 million for Project Fraius. The renewal with Fenionox Freight closes at $155.2 million a year, 29.1 percent above the last contract.

Subject: Key rotation — Wavecrest preview service

Hi all, and welcome to the new joiners. The Wavecrest service that renders audio waveform previews for the Tidepool editor rotated its credentials this morning as part of our quarterly schedule. The old key stops working at end of day Friday, so update your local configs before then. Please replace your existing entry with the new key below.

gateway credential: kto23_LX9A4ys6i4nzHtpOLNLodKK